The ego is an insidious thing. Ego is such a small part of who we are, but we make it so much bigger than it deserves to be. The ego will have you believe that you are never successful – you should always be striving for more, more, more. Think about it, how many people around you feel blessed with what they already have? Do you have any friends who have a bigger house than you do and still can’t stop thinking about what more they could have? It is happening more than you might think – even though it may not be advertised out there for everyone to hear. Some say it is human nature to want more. It isn’t – it is ego nature.
